National Intern Day, created by WayUp and observed annually on the last Thursday of July, is dedicated to honoring the contributions of interns and the programs that develop them. The Top 100 Internship Programs List, now in its tenth annual edition, represents the culmination of months of nominations and evaluation by industry experts and the broader public.

The selection process combines rigorous expert judgment with public participation. According to Yello, which publishes the list in partnership with WayUp, hundreds of employers submitted nominations this year, and the final rankings were determined by a panel of industry experts who reviewed each anonymized nomination alongside 115,000 public votes cast by interns and employers.
Expert panelists scored programs based on six key criteria: professional development, intern engagement, company culture, conversion opportunities, compensation, and unique program elements. This multi-faceted evaluation ensures the list reflects programs that prioritize both the immediate intern experience and long-term career outcomes.
The 2025 list offers insight into what top internship programs deliver. Kimley-Horn claimed the number-one spot by setting what Yello described as “the gold standard for what an internship can be.” The engineering and design firm integrates interns directly into client work, pairs them with mentors including former interns who have advanced to executive roles, and provides structured feedback from supervisors, teammates, and firm leaders. The program’s success is reflected in its conversion rate: over 20 percent of Kimley-Horn’s current full-time employees were former interns, including the company’s current president, who began as an intern in 1994.

Beyond the top ranking, the 2025 list recognized specialty award winners in four categories. The American Heart Association won the Public Service Award for designing an internship program where interns directly contribute to nationwide health initiatives and CPR education campaigns. Fulcrum Global Technologies earned the Intern Growth Award for its 13-week startup incubator model, where interdisciplinary teams of interns co-found real companies with legal and operational support. General Dynamics received the Innovation Award for combining professional development with high-impact perks and real-world defense and cybersecurity challenges, achieving a conversion rate exceeding 65 percent. Valmark Financial Group won the Small but Mighty Award, demonstrating that companies with fewer than 1,000 employees can build powerful talent pipelines through full integration, dedicated mentorship, and continuous feedback.
Common themes across top programs reveal what employers are prioritizing. Leading internship programs fully integrate interns into company life—from employee resource groups and wellness benefits to executive Q&As and cross-functional projects. Many programs build community through peer mentorship, returning intern leadership roles, and structured feedback models. Professional development is increasingly layered, with variations of the 70/20/10 model combining hands-on experience, coaching, and formal training. Resume reviews, mock interviews, and development sessions aligned to professional competencies have become standard offerings.
